The Hamilton Wildcats posted their closest victory yet this season on Wednesday. They sure made it a nail-biter, but they managed to escape with a 60-57 win over Kirby. Having run the score up that high, both teams might be doing some extra defensive drills very soon.
Hamilton's victory was a true team effort, with many players turning in solid performances. Perhaps the best among them was Timothy Matthews, who dropped a double-double on 14 points and 12 rebounds. Another player making a difference was Rodney Mcneal, who scored 15 points along with six assists and two steals.
The victory makes it two in a row for Hamilton and bumps their season record up to 8-11. As for Kirby, they are on a five-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 5-11.
